Officials play a key role in any sailing race or regatta! Sail Canada’s Officer, Judge and Umpire programs provide club training and certification at the national level, while World Sailing provides international certification.

Event volunteers are always in high demand! Whether it’s helping on site at an event or being a key member of the organizing committee, there’s a role for everyone!
